         <title>What is performance management/appraisal?</title>
         <author>220153679</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/220153679/hj06urj0pktgjlsg/wish/1702597393</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div><strong><em>What is it?</em></strong><br>Performance appraisal/management is a form of review used to assess or look at an employees overall&nbsp; job performance and overall contribution to a company.They are used by employers to justify or determine the contribution that the employee has made to the organisations growth and progress.'<br>'Performance&nbsp; appraisal (or performance evaluation) refers</div><div>to the methods and processes used by organizations to assess the level of performance of their employees. This process usually includes measuring employees’performance and providing them with feedback regarding the level and quality of their performance' (DeNisi and Pritchard, 2006). &nbsp;</div><div><br><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>Why is performance management/appraisal important?</title>
         <author>220153679</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/220153679/hj06urj0pktgjlsg/wish/1702601196</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div><br></div><ul><li>Clarifies the role and status an employee plays in an organisation.</li><li>Self Development: an employee can receive positive feedback where they excel and if not they can set up training or developmental programs with their managers.</li><li>Motivates employees if they are supported by good merit-based compensation system. The best performers get better pay and benefits packages and the under performers are easily detected and can be penalized.</li><li>Statistics can be used to monitor the organisations growth, recruitment an induction processes.</li><li>Performance appraisal systems also help management and the organisation to be able to adequately decide about promotions , transfers and rewards of employees.(Idowu,2017)</li></ul>]]></description>

         <title>Who is responsible for managing the performance appraisal and how often should it be done?</title>
         <author>220153679</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/220153679/hj06urj0pktgjlsg/wish/1702616590</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Performance appraisals are mostly conducted by line managers and superiors of the employees to assess their employees, however depending on the type of appraisal system used peers can appraise each other as well as customers too if a 360 appraisal system is used. <br><br><strong><em>How often are performance appraisals done?<br></em></strong>Ideally these performance appraisals are an ongoing process that<strong><em> </em></strong>are represented by formal meetings which can be done on a 6 to 12 month interval.</div>]]></description>

         <title>What information is required for performance management/appraisal?</title>
         <author>220153679</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/220153679/hj06urj0pktgjlsg/wish/1702767356</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Employees need to be aware of what is expected of them so that they can perform well. When being appraised employers should include a detailed job description that describes the essential functions, tasks and responsibilities of the job at hand.<br>Appraisal should include :&nbsp;</div><ul><li>Performance threshold(s),</li><li>Requirement(s), or</li><li>Expectation(s)</li></ul><div>other information that can be included is: the name of the employee, date the performance form was completed, dates specifying the time interval over which the employee is being evaluated, performance dimensions (include responsibilities from the job description, any assigned goals from the strategic plan, along with needed skills, such as communications, administration, etc.), a rating system (e.g., poor, average, good, excellent), space for commentary for each dimension, a final section for overall commentary, a final section for action plans to address improvements, and lines for signatures of the supervisor and employee.</div><div><br>&nbsp;</div>]]></description>

         <title>What can be done with the outcomes of a performance appraisal?</title>
         <author>220153679</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/220153679/hj06urj0pktgjlsg/wish/1702806305</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>With the outcomes of a performance appraisal the employee's competency gaps can be identified and areas of improvement in the performance can be suggested. Managers can take the necessary steps to help the employees improve on those areas,.<br>The identification of high achieving or high potential employees can be done which can be incorporated into the succession plan of the organisation.<br>The results of these outcomes can be beneficial for compensation systems.</div>]]></description>

         <title>How do we ensure the performance management/appraisal process is ethical?</title>
         <author>220153679</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/220153679/hj06urj0pktgjlsg/wish/1702820207</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div><strong><em>Use uniform rating criteria: </em></strong>Avoid and eliminate differences in outcomes caused by disorderly systems which may result in unethical results or outcomes<strong><em>.<br>Eliminate Personal Prejudice and remove friendship factor: </em></strong>The assessor should remove any personal bias they may have towards the employee be it about their race, ethnicity or gender. If prejudice is not removed you may assess an individual unfairly. Also the manager or assessor must be able to remove themselves from their personal relationship with the employee if there is and assess fairly. If they are unable to do so they must remove themselves from that.(Chron Contributor, 2020)<br><br></div>]]></description>
